In connection with the City of Gainesville’s recognition of Indigenous Peoples’ Week and other programs across the university, the Harn is proud to partner with Indigenous and Native collaborators across the city and campus.

Join us for: 

  • Hands-on art activities 
  • Artist demonstrations by local artists Mario Mutis and Sylvestre Reyes  
  • Beading workshop with artist Yona Ovdiyenko
  • Dance demonstration by powwow performers, Duane Whitehorse, Maria Whitehorse-Izzary and Terell Anquoe honor storytelling through movement and music.  

 

Offered in collaboration with The Indigenous People’s Task Force, Indigenous American Student Association (IASA), Gator Chapter of the American Indian Science and Engineering Society (AISES), George Smathers Libraries, UF School of Theatre and Dance, UF American Indian and Indigenous Studies
